Origin and History of the name Kostin

This name derives from the Latin name “Cōstantīnus”, taken in turn from the original “con- stō > cōnstō > cōnstāns”, meaning “standstill, steady, solid, firm, steady, resolute, tenacious, determined”.

Constantine the Great (Flavius Valerius Aurelius Constantinus Augustus) was Roman Emperor from 306 to 337.

Well known for being the first Roman emperor to convert to Christianity, Constantine and co-Emperor Licinius issued the Edict of Milan in 313, which proclaimed tolerance of all religions throughout the empire.

Constantine was a minor king in 6th-century sub-Roman Britain, who was remembered in later British tradition as a legendary King of Britain.
